    The North American Charging System (NACS), standardized as SAE J3400, is an electric vehicle (EV) charging connector standard maintained by SAE International. [1] Developed by Tesla, Inc., it has been used by all North American market Tesla vehicles since 2021 and was opened for use by other manufacturers in November 2022.

    Charging station and vehicle terminology. In 2011, the European Automobile Manufacturers Association (ACEA) defined the following terms: [2] Socket outlet: the port on the electric vehicle supply equipment (EVSE) that supplies charging power to the vehicle; Plug: the end of the flexible cable that interfaces with the socket outlet on the EVSE.

    Electrify America, LLC is an electric vehicle DC fast-charging network in the United States, with more than 950 stations and over 4,250 DC fast charging connectors as of August 2024.
